A VENEZUELAN STATION and THE FALLS OF "EL NEGRO" CUYUNI RIVER
By Harry Fenn
Located in Portland, ME
Fenn, Harry. A VENEZUELAN STATION and THE FALLS OF "EL NEGRO" CUYUNI RIVER. Ink and wash, 1896. Two drawings, the original artwork for illustrations accompanying "Glimpses of Venzuela," an article by W. Nephew King published in Century Magazine, July, 1896, pp. 358-368. Each about 9 x 11 inches, in very good condition, and framed. King is best known for his writings about the Spanish-American War of 1898. Harry Fenn, 1845-1911, was born in England, but worked in the United States. He was a painter, and printmaker, but is known primarily as a book and magazine illustrator. Where Wild Hibiscus Grows, Absecon Island, NJ, Watercolor of Jersey Shore 1894
Located in Philadelphia, PA
Peter Caledon Cameron
(American, born Scotland, 1852-c. 1920)
Absecon Island, New Jersey, 1894
Watercolor on paper, 17 1/2 x 27 inches (sight)
FRAMED: 26 1/2 x 36 1/2 inches
Signed and dated at lower left: "ABSECON.ISLAND./ N.J-U.S.A Cameron/1894" N.J-U.S.A Cameron/1894"
Born in Perth, Scotland, Peter Caledon Cameron won awards for drawing and penmanship at a Glasgow public school. He claimed that at the age of fourteen his watercolors were already "in demand," and that before turning twenty he had "crossed every ocean in the world, sketching and painting as he went." He attended the Government School of Design in London and was certified as an art master in 1883. Cameron immigrated to the United States that year, settled in Philadelphia, and commenced work on large history paintings such as Niagara in Winter (unlocated) and Vesuvius in Grand Eruption (unlocated) that he exhibited in various northern cities. He exhibited one painting at the Pennsylvania Academy of the Fine Arts in 1902. Nothing is known of his activities later in life.
In a lengthy inscription that accompanies this watercolor, Cameron noted that Absecon was "a piece of the best sand-dune region characteristic of the whole coast of New Jersey State from Sandy Hook point in the North to Cape May Point in the extreme south." In the forest of Durlach - Quiet ripple in a secret place -
Located in Berlin, DE
Franz Xaver Graessel (1861 Oberasbach/Baden - 1948 Emmering). In the forest of Durlach. 1881. Pencil drawing, heightened with white, on grey-green paper. 33 x 41.7 cm. Signed, dated and inscribed by the artist himself: 'Franz Graessel. Durlach, 12 April 1881".
About the artwork
The drawing depicts a view of the woods which, as if sharpening the visual focus, remains diffuse at the edges and does not allow the viewer to locate himself in the picture. As a result, the landscape appears to be an apparition, but at the same time it is given real substance by the solidity of the massive arched bridge made of quarry stone. As the main motif of the painting, the bridge, which blends in with nature like an archaic relic, also acts as a visual guide, drawing attention to the white, raised waters of the stream and the surrounding vegetation. The diffusion of perception that takes place there, however, draws the eye back to the bridge and thus to the overall view. This movement initiating a constant alternation of diffusion and concretion, which is the specific tension of the painting that brings the landscape to life. The materialisation and dematerialisation, however, does not take place solely through the eye's wandering through the picture; it is simultaneously linked to the viewer's approach to and distance from the picture, which loses its richness of detail precisely in the close-up, only to reconfigure itself with increasing distance.
In this work, which dates from Graessel's studies in Karlsruhe, the artist reflects on the emergence of pictorial objectivity. Here, however, nature is more than a mere motif. The real connection between culture and nature is symbolically expressed by the choice of green paper.
The drawing is an impressive testimony to Graessel's mastery of the sprezzatura with which he skilfully applies the most abstract of strokes, which visibly merge towards the centre of the picture. The signature and the exact date prove that Graessel gave this work more than the character of a mere sketch.
About the artist
Franz Graessel grew up in an environment that was to nourish his later key motifs: his parents' house was a mill. After attending the Karlsruhe Academy of Art from 1878 to 1884, where he studied under Carl Hoff, Graessel continued his training at the Munich Academy from 1886 to 1890 as a pupil of Wilhelm von Lindenschmidt. Trained primarily in genre and portrait painting, he initially portrayed the life of Black Forest farmers. From 1894 he turned increasingly to animal painting, concentrating on the depiction of ducks and geese, which earned him the nickname 'Enten-Graessel'.
